Change Healthcare Inc. is a healthcare technology company. The Company is focused on the transformation of the healthcare system through its Change Healthcare platform. The Company operates through three business segments: Software and Analytics, Network Solutions, and Technology-Enabled Services. Its Software and Analytics segment provide solutions for revenue cycle management, provider network management, payment accuracy, value-based payments, clinical decision support, consumer engagement, risk adjustment and quality performance, and imaging and clinical workflow. Its Network Solutions segment provide solutions for financial, administrative, and clinical and pharmacy transactions, electronic payments and aggregation and analytics of clinical and financial data. Its Technology-Enabled Services segment provides solutions for financial and administrative management, value-based care, communication and payment, pharmacy benefits administration and healthcare consulting.
